Rudmuli is a small village of 510 hectares in Bah Tehsil in Agra district in the State of Uttar Pradesh, India.[2] The village is administrated by a sarpanch who is elected representative of the village by the local elections. Rudmuli depends on Bah (MB), the nearest town for all major economic activities.[3] The village has government-provided water facilities that include One tap, One Well supply, One tubewell, and One handpump. The villagers also acquire water from some of the natural water sources. The population of the village depends on the source of drinking water during summer on Tap. Rudmuli's pin code is 283104[4], and village code is 01642900. The area of Rudmuli is segregated as 231 hectares irrigated area, 84 hectares unirrigated, the 55 hectare area under culturable waste (including gauchar and groves), and remaining 202 hectare area not available for cultivation.

Rudmuli has One post office (Rudhmuli B.O). The village is connected with a single bus service. Rudmuli has One bank, One credit society and One agricultural credit society for the regulation of economic activity. The village is also equipped with Two recreational centers.

The village has an uninterrupted 24 hours electric supply from a power grid.

Demographics

Rudmuli is a census village in the district of Agra, Uttar Pradesh. The village has a total population of 1445 and has total administration over 251 houses which are connected to supplies basic amenities like water and sewerage.

  • Rudmuli has 248 children, 128 boys and 120 girls.
  • Scheduled caste counts for 198 (13.70%) males constitute 103 (7.13%) of the population and females 95 (6.57%).

Educational institutions

As per the census 2011 report, 950 people are literate in Rudmuli out of which 534 are males and 416 are females.

Rudmuli has the following educational facilities:

  • 1 Education facility
  • 1 Primary school
  • 1 Upper primary school
  • 2 Colleges in the nearby range
  • 1 Adult literacy center

Employment

According to a census 2011 report, 332 people of the total population are employed. The workforce is 291 male, 41 female with 241 (72.59%) of all workers being employed full-time, this includes 227 males and 14 females. 152 males and 2 females are considered as the main cultivators with the help of 26 males. 91 people are reported to work for a marginal period of time in the year.

They depend on the agricultural markets (Mandi) of the nearby towns of Bah (MB) and Agra to sell earthen pottery and make their living.
